Transaction ef76e33f93a169e441b8c8a1e0af7694fdfb57ab28f9926f6fda50b4575eaba2
1 Input
1 Output
-
ef76e33f93a169e441b8c8a1e0af7694fdfb57ab28f9926f6fda50b4575eaba2:0
- value
- 403760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ea3ed392e9d5f73dbaa0e736fdfe47bedd58779 OP_EQUAL
- address
- 3EhEFcB4Q26Unp2jdjUupEPMgeeSSKDbu1